Anchoring the Family Ship: Thriving with Predictability and Variety on a 2 2 3 Schedule
In the journey of family life, navigating the ebb and flow of schedules can feel like steering a ship through unpredictable waters. However, with the 2 2 3 schedule, families can anchor themselves in a routine that provides both predictability and variety. This schedule involves children spending two days with one parent, two days with the other, and then three days with the first parent before switching again. Just like a well-balanced ship, this schedule offers stability while also allowing for the excitement of new experiences.
Like the dependable anchor of a ship, the 2 2 3 schedule provides children with a sense of security and stability. Knowing what to expect and when to expect it can offer children a sense of comfort and reliability. This routine also allows both parents to actively participate in their children’s daily lives, fostering a strong sense of family unity and togetherness. At the same time, the 2 2 3 schedule offers the variety of spending equal time with both parents, allowing children to enjoy diverse experiences and build strong bonds with each parent.

The 2 2 3 schedule, often used in co-parenting arrangements, can be the wind in our sails, steering us towards the serenity and harmony we seek. But what exactly is a 2 2 3 schedule?
Simply put, a 2 2 3 schedule is a pattern of shared custody where one parent has the child for two days, the other parent for two days, and then the first parent for three days. This alternating schedule allows for consistent contact with both parents, promoting stability and comfort for the child. Additionally, it provides ample opportunities for bonding, nurturing, and shared experiences, strengthening the parental bond and fostering a sense of security in the child.
